Big Bone Lick Historical Association (Boone County, Ky.)
Description
The Boone County Historical Society ultimately formed the Big Bone Lick Historical Association to promote the establishment of Big Bone Lick as a state park. After many years of tireless efforts in promotion, education, and fundraising, these determined members purchased 16 2/3 acres in December 1959. They presented the land to the Commonwealth of Kentucky to establish a state park.
In December 1960 the Department of Parks announced plans to develop picnic areas and a shelter house. Thus, Big Bone Lick State Park was born.
